Install the integration

  1. Log in to Autohive and navigate to Your user profile > Connections or Your workspace -> Manage workspace

  2. Locate the Box Integration card and click Connect

    List of integrations in Autohive
  3. Authorize with Box - you’ll be redirected to Box’s authorization page

  4. Review and approve permissions. Autohive requests access to:

    Ensure you approve the permissions required in order for the integration to function as expected.

  5. Confirm installation - you’ll be redirected to Autohive with “Connected” status displayed


Use the integration

You can now use the integration with your agents, workflows and scheduled tasks!

  1. Follow our Create your first agent guide on how to create an agent.
  2. In the ‘Agent settings’, scroll down to the ‘Add capabilities’ section and turn on the Box capability. You can choose what individual Box capabilities to turn on and off.
  3. Once the settings have been selected, begin prompting the agent of the workflow you’d like to achieve with Autohive and Box!

Available capabilities

File Management

  • Get File: Download and access file content with complete metadata including creation and modification dates
  • Upload File: Store new files in Box with base64 content encoding and folder organization
  • File Discovery: Search and locate files across your entire Box account with advanced filtering

Folder Operations

  • List Shared Folders: Access all shared folders and collaborative workspaces with pagination support
  • List Folder Contents: Browse specific folders with support for recursive directory traversal
  • Folder Navigation: Efficiently navigate complex folder hierarchies and nested structures

Advanced Search and Discovery

  • List Files: Search files across your account with query-based filtering and extension-specific searches
  • Content Filtering: Filter files by name, content, file extensions, and metadata criteria
  • Folder-Specific Search: Limit searches to specific folders or directory branches

Content Organization

  • Pagination Support: Handle large file collections efficiently with token-based pagination
  • Metadata Access: Retrieve comprehensive file information including sizes, dates, and properties
  • Binary File Handling: Support for all file types with base64 encoding for binary data

Disconnect the integration

Important: Disconnecting stops data synchronization but preserves existing data in both systems.

  1. Navigate to Your user profile -> Connections or Your workspace -> Manage workspace
  2. Find the Box Integration
  3. Click Disconnect and confirm

Data Impact: Existing data remains unchanged in both systems, but sync stops and Autohive loses Box API access.


Uninstall the app

From Box: Go to your Box account settings > Apps > Find Autohive and revoke access
